Second City Style and W Chicago Host SCS's 3 Year Anniversary "Fashion Birthday Bash"

Award winning online fashion magazine champions the Chicago fashionista and independent designers to a global audience.

Chicago (PRWEB) September 4, 2008 -- In partnership with W Chicago, Second City Style will host an Anniversary event on Thursday, September 18th, 2008 at the W Chicago - City Center location from 6pm to 8pm. The event celebrates three years of the best in fashion & beauty reporting. Second City Style, launched first as an online fashion magazine, and has recently expanded to include a blog and an online boutique showcasing independent designers. "After three years we wanted to thank our readers in Chicago for their support with an upscale, fashion inspired birthday party. We wanted to meet them in person as the Internet is obviously impersonal," say Lauren Dimet Walters, Co-Founder and Editor and Chief.

Attendees will experience an array of decadent sweets, fun fashion inspired party games, hors d'oeuvres and Midori cocktails. The designers of the SecondCityStore.com Store will be on hand to mingle with the crowd and give guests a peek at must-haves for fall. The store, launched a year and a half ago, was born out of the desire to connect with their national audience. "Since many of our readers are from all over the country and world we felt there was a great opportunity to showcase some of the amazing talent in our local designers, we created Second City Store. In addition to Chicago based designers, we have added some designers from NY," says Carol Calacci, Co-Founder and Managing Editor. During the event, guests will also have an opportunity to purchase select items at the onsite boutique, taking their online shopping experience live.

Millions of readers trust Second City Style's daily dose of fashion musings, international headlines and premier shopping. Voted 2006 Best Fashion Blog by Glam.com (largest women's site online) and one of two Best Fashion Website in Chicago Magazine's 2008 "Top 171 Websites", the site has become a online destination for fashionable women around the globe. "We came up with this crazy idea to challenge the women of Chicago to step it up a notch when it comes to fashion. What better way than with an online magazine? So in September of 2005 we launched SecondCityStyle.com. The e-zine is published once a week and and is written by a staff of contributing writers. The blog came about a year later because we had a lot more to say. Thus the creation of the blog. And the rest, as they say, is history. Now we have readers who contact us from Malaysia, Northwest Canada, Europe and everywhere else," says Lauren.

The event is free to the public. Additional event and rsvp information is available at www.secondcitystyle.com.

About Second City Style
Pleasure. Luxury. Wit. Second City Style is the award-winning guide to luxury, style and beauty. This weekly published online fashion magazine and daily updated blog has been heralded as a daily must-read for fashionistas everywhere. Published by Editor-in-Chief, Lauren Dimet Waters and Managing Editor, Carol Calacci, Second City Style is a consumer-driven publication. The online magazine content and design are created out of hundreds of surveys from Chicago-area women. This invaluable feedback provides a one-on-one relationship with Chicago women that inform each editorial choice. SCS has been quoted in: The Chicago Tribune, Time Out Chicago, Chicago Magazine, CBS News, AOL, San Francisco Gate, Denver Post, The Ledger, South West Style, Buffalo News and more.
